Three people are in custody today, Friday 18th November, after a stolen car crashed in West Harptree in the early hours of this morning after being taken from Bath overnight.
The crash on Harptree Hill was reported just after 3.15am. The car, a Porsche 911, was later confirmed to have been stolen from an address in Bath overnight.
Two men and a woman were arrested at 5.45am on the A368 in Bishops Sutton in connection with the incident and remain in police custody at this time.
